Coronavirus (COVID-19) Advocacy

The ADA is lobbied Congress and the administration to protect dental patients and staff who are providing urgent and emergency care during the COVID-19 pandemic. The ADA is also lobbed to help dental practices stay viable during (and following) prolonged periods of reduced hours or closure.
